Unlike SEO keywords, GEO requires monitoring complex conversational prompts across AI platforms. Without proper organization:
Data chaos: Hundreds of prompts with no structure
Lost insights: Can't see performance patterns
Reporting nightmares: No way to segment results
Wasted effort: Duplicate tracking and missed opportunities
Create custom tags matching your business structure:
Campaign Tags: Product launches, seasonal campaigns, brand initiatives, competitor tracking
Geographic Tags: Regional markets, language variations, local vs. global prompts
Product Tags: Categories, service types, feature-specific prompts, use cases
Intent Tags: Informational queries, transactional prompts, comparison searches

Start Simple: Begin with 2-3 essential tags (product, campaign, region). You can always add more as patterns emerge.
Create Tag Hierarchy: Use parent-child relationships like "Product-Mobile" and "Product-Desktop" for granular analysis while maintaining broad categories.
Maintain Consistency: Document your tagging conventions in a shared guide. Inconsistent tagging destroys analytical value across teams.
Tag Immediately: Make tagging part of your prompt creation workflow. Retroactive tagging is time-consuming and error-prone.
Regular Audits: Review your tag structure monthly. Merge redundant tags and archive unused ones to keep the system clean.
Think Like Your Reports: Design tags around how stakeholders want to see data - by business unit, campaign type, or competitive focus.
